The Best Opaque Tights There Are

Opaque tights are a tricky beast; sometimes they’re too light, other times they rip really easily. And most of them have that obnoxious little elastic waistband that lends itself to endless fidgeting. But for those of us who wear skirts and dresses all winter long, they’re a necessary evil. Being a hater of regular pants myself, I fall into this skirt-wearing, tights-needing category. Extensive research has finally lead me to arguably the best opaque tights out there. I’ve tried Fogal and Wolford at $50-$80 a pop, American Apparel for $20 a pair and everything in between. As it turns out, though, 2/$20 HUE Super Opaques are far and away better than the competition. They’re totally opaque instead of that in-between BS. They don’t rip easily and are super comfortable and generally sleek-looking. Time to stock up! Keep reading »

Quick Video: Adidas SLVRL Fall 2009 Collection

Can we give Adidas an A+ for creativity? Usually, clothing lines create a catalog or look book to show off the latest clothes for the season. But for their SLVR Label Autumn/Winter 2009-2010 collection, Adidas has added a short video that anyone can watch on YouTube. (FYI: The video was directed by Theo Stanley and features music by Sam Wagster, all under the creative direction of Pietsch Lim.) This one-minute video feels very much like a collage of sound and images, and it’s a cool way to view the clothing, if not a little too artsy. Eh, see what you think.
